product manager principal – Service & Contact Center Technology (Seattle OR Remote)

Job Summary and Mission

At Starbucks, our mission is to inspire and nurture the human spirit – one person, one cup, and one neighborhood at a time. Starbucks Technologists work to achieve this mission using cutting-edge technology delivered to our partners, customers, stores, roasters, and global communities.

This position contributes to Starbucks success by assuming end-to-end responsibility for the strategic value, usability, and performance of one or more of our digital products. This position acts as the leader and subject matter expert in delivering a rationalized and modern global technology platform for Starbucks contact centers and our IT Service Management. We design, build, and nurture a digital ecosystem that elevates the experiences and capabilities for our partners and customers. The primary platforms leveraged in this space are ServiceNow and AWS Connect but are not limited to these.

To be successful, the principal product manager, needs to be an expert in managing complex and ambiguous initiatives while managing cross functional expectations – including but not limited to: feature sets, problem areas, timelines, and change requests. They need to have a passion for building the right capabilities for our partners and our customers balanced with the analytical rigor to test, measure, and iterate to deliver on the best experiences and business value.

Summary of Key Responsibilities

Responsibilities and essential job functions include but are not limited to the following:

  • Partners with business stakeholders on problem definition & drive alignment on business goals, UX goals and defining target KPIs for the feature.
  • Defines and builds the product strategy, influencing teams and leaders to gain alignment.
  • Builds and creates user flows/ experiences.
  • Directs non-functional requirements including performance, usability, accessibility, disaster recovery & business continuity.
  • May arrange demos and RFIs for vendor solutions; decision maker in solution/vendor selection; responsible for influence and align with cross-functional teams.
  • Determines technical feasibility, dependencies, and constraints of features with support from neighboring technology teams as needed.
  • Effectively partners, collaborates, and influences at all levels to position and support complex engagements.
  • Prioritization and ownership across multiple deliverables and cross-team initiatives.
  • Perform Feature Readouts with 2nd level insights (broader and deeper hypothesis driven complete analysis) per measurement plan, identify proxy data sources as needed to troubleshoot issues.
  • Able to manage tradeoffs on scope, resources, timeline on multiple, complex feature sets.
  • Creates product update communications independently varying from release announcements to content for executive review and decision making.
  • Stays abreast of new technology capabilities and leverages knowledge in contributing to product solutions. Recommends and plans innovative products and features.
  • Partners with technical product managers and/or engineering to scope and prioritize upcoming projects into the roadmap.
  • Manages a cross-team product roadmap.
  • Builds effective relationships with key stakeholders and cross functional teams.
  • Directly communicates and influences alignment of feature sizing and delivery planning with stakeholders; communication is typically at Steering Committee level and above.
  • Presents and leads alignment of tradeoffs with decision makers, typically at Steering Committee level and above.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ience in a related field.
  • Demonstrated ability to use analytics and optimization tools to inform product planning and prioritization (5+ years).
  • Demonstrated ability to work with design and engineering to deliver customer facing features (5+ years).
  • Hands on experience in developing roadmaps, priorities, features, story outlines, writing user stories, and coordinating/prioritizing conflicting requirements in a fast-paced, changing environment with variety of stakeholders (7 years).
  • Managing product delivery and release in an agile environment (3 years).
  • Industry experience in a technology environment with a record of successfully delivering complex products (10+ years).
